2016-10-12 12 views
0

나는 그리드의 데이터로 객체를 사용합니다. 이러한 개체에는 텍스트 값과 임의의 양의 문제가 포함됩니다. 텍스트가 셀에 표시되고 문제 메시지가 각 셀의 AutoTooltips 플러그인을 통해 툴팁으로 표시됩니다. 지금까지 잘 작동합니다.SlickGrid, AutoTooltips 플러그인을 사용하여 툴팁에서 텍스트 복사

내 문제 : 툴팁에서 텍스트를 복사하고 싶습니다. 그러나 : 마우스가 셀을 떠나는 순간 툴팁이 사라지고 도구 팁을 입력하고 텍스트를 복사하기 위해 (예를 들어, 마우스가 움직이는 한) 툴팁을 '활성'상태로 유지하는 방법을 알 수 없습니다 . AutoTooltips 플러그인을 사용하여이를 달성 할 수있는 방법이 있습니까?

답변

0

AutoTooltips 플러그인은 title 속성 만 추가합니다. 코드를 변경하거나 툴팁을 생성하고 텍스트를 복사 할 수있는 다른 라이브러리/스크립트를 추가해야합니다.

체크 http://jquerytools.github.io/demos/tooltip/index.html.

구현하려면 그리드/행이 렌더링 된 후 $ (grid_container) .tooltip() 코드를 추가하십시오.

+0

답장을 보내 주셔서 감사합니다. 나는 JQueryTools을 얻을 수있었습니다. 나는 텍스트를 직접 title으로 설정하는 대신 직접 전달하는 것과 같은 약간의 수정을했으며 거의 ​​원하는대로 작동합니다. 고마워! 그러나 여전히 한 가지 쟁점이 남아 있습니다. tooltip은 셀에 대한 tooltip-function의 첫 번째 호출에서 나타나지 않지만 2 차 이후의 호출에서는 팝업됩니다. 이 행동에 대한 이유를 생각해 볼 수 있습니까? – lenno

+0

그리드가 완전히 렌더링되었는지 확인해야합니다. 프로 시저 어쩌면 또는 settimeout 체인 – winghei